U20 World Cup: Barcelona Super Kid Who Admires Messi Reveals USA's Plan To Beat Nigeria
Published: May 27, 2019
There will be no margin for errors when the United States take on the Flying Eagles at the 2019 U20 World Cup on Monday evening after they lost their opening game to Ukraine.
One of the key players for the United States side is Barcelona winger Konrad De La Fuente, who admires the best player on the planet Lionel Messi and has drawn comparisons with the two-footed Ousmane Dembélé.
De La Fuente has revealed how they plan to beat the Nigeria U20s and acknowledged that it would be a difficult game against the physical Africans.
''We are optimists. In the first meeting the result was unfavorable, but we played well. With Nigeria, we must be more patient, create more fringe opportunities and improve efficiency,'' De La Fuente told Dziennik Zachodni.
''A difficult meeting awaits us, because Nigeria is a physically strong team. But we look only at ourselves. If we present our best football, we will definitely win.''
Another three points for the Flying Eagles today would be enough to get Paul Aigbogun's team through to the knockout rounds of the FIFA U20 World Cup.
